Output eee2620a8cd5178fd84294dac5662b49ab7f953557f9a1cbb5b53b1538b0146e:3

value
66089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c31b91d27e43c11cb1c5dc5943569521f3fd9433 OP_EQUAL
address
3KUeiXC2MsEgab1GTAmNeXyuXgdaCMVDC1
transaction
eee2620a8cd5178fd84294dac5662b49ab7f953557f9a1cbb5b53b1538b0146e
spent
true